COMMERCE BUSINESS DAILY ISSUE OF JULY 30,1996 PSA#1647

General Services Admin, 1941 Jeff Davis Hwy, Crystal Mall, Room 503, Washington, DC 20406

66 -- PRE-INVITATION NOTICE FOR SCHEDULE 66, SOL FCGS-Y5-0032-2-N DUE 080796 POC Evangeline Turner on 703-305-6322, Tracy sentelle on 703-3056777or Brenda Yates on 703-305-6392 The Scientific Equipment Division invites you to participate in the second open Season covering Federal supply schedule FSC group 66, part II, section J, instruments and laboratory equipment, for the period of June 1, 1997 (or date ofaward, whichever is later) through may 31, 2003 (see the extension clausebelow). This will be an indefinite delivery, indefinite quantity contract, fobdestination. Use of the schedule will be on a non-mandatory basis. Anyone considering submitting an offer is advised to review the entire Solicitation andadmendments to It thoroughly. Significant changes: O a new modifications provision which allows current contractors to offer new special item Numbers (SINS) under a modification request at any time during the contract period. Therefore, current contractors are not requested to submit an offer under this open Season. O a new warranty provision which allows for the incorporation of thecontractor'S standard Commercial warranty. O all current contracts under this multiple award schedule Solicitation will be modified separately during the second open Season period to include an option to extend the term of the contract for an additional five years, clause I-FSS-164-dwill apply. In the event the contractor does not wish to exercise the option toextend, they may submit a new proposal for a new contract during the next openseason, which will be issued on or about September 1997. O the Scientific Equipment Division will consider a submission for identical items (items currently covered by a group 66, part II, section J contract) when the initial offer is equal to or lower than the current contract price. When this occurs, the Contracting Officer shall conduct competitive negotiations with new offerors and current contractors who have the identical items on contract. The Contracting Officer will award one contract for each specific product through competitive negotiations on the basis of the best net price offered. Identical items will be considered during the open Season period only, with noexceptions. Any offers for identical items received after the open Season period for submission of offers will be automatically rejected. O clause I-FSS-125, orders exceeding the maximum order ''Mo'' (August 1995) willapply. This clause provides instruction for placing orders over the maximum order as defined in the order limitation clause 52.216-19. To assist the customer agencies to determine when they should seek a price decrease, a level called the maximum order will be established under each contract. O the Scientific Equipment Division proposes to add five (5) additional special item Numbers (SINS) under group 66, part II, section J. The SINS are asfollows:627-34-antenna pattern measurement systems and directly related accessories and options. Includes systems for determining radiation transmission patterns of antennas.627-35-relay and circuit breaker test sets and directly related accessories and options.627-36-aircraft navigation Signal analyzers ADN direcltly related accessories and options. Includes instruments and systems for analyzing aircraft guidance signals such as localizer, glide slope, Marker beacon and vor signals.627-37-radar test sets and directly related accessories and options. It includes sets for analyzing and testing various radar types including beacon radar and transponders.627-38-global positioning system (GPS) receiver test sets and directly related accessories and options. The scientific equipment is pleased to announce for the first time It will besoliciting offers for product support options for Government ownedequipment/accessories covered by contract under this Federal supply schedule. The product support options include: O equipment maintenanceo pre-purchase calibrationo Post purchase calibrationo extended warrantyo service agreementso technical trainingo technical/application development support in order to provide product support options, an offeror must be an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) or be (OEM) approved and certified. Offers will be accepted for product support options only; however, only one contract (with the lowest Government price) will be awarded for any Signal Model. An offer must comply with any regulatory requirements, guidelines, and/or standards which govern the particular equipment/accessory/part, and are of Commercial practice. Also, the offers will be solicited on the basis that the offeror must, at aminimum, provided coverage to the 48 contiguous States and the district ofcolumbia. Offers will also be accepted additionally for coverage in Alaska, Hawaii and the commonwealth of Puerto Rico. (all additional terms and conditions for product support options will be contained in the open seasonamendment). As synopsized in the Commerce Business Daily (CBD) dated April 29, 1996, the Scientific Equipment Division also invites you to offer products under the ''newtechnologies'' special item number (SIN) 627-1007 which has been added to the group 66, part II, section J Federal supply schedule. New Technologies is a new product made available to the Commercial or Government Market place. This will be an open-continuous (Evergreen) special item number (SIN). All interested parties may submit an offer at any time. However, there is NO implied gurarantee that the products offered will be recognized and accepted as new technology. New offerors or current contractors must submit a cover letter, applicable technical brochures and currentpricelist(S). All material submitted will be reviewed for acceptance by the Government'S technical experts. If the offered item(S) are found acceptable by the Government, a ''new offeror'' will be issued a copy of the schedule 66, partii, section J Solicitation along with all applicable amendments. Current contractors will request a modification to their contract. All forms would then be submitted to the Contracting Officer to be evaluated for a contract. Contractors awarded a contract under this multiple award schedule will be required to place their pricelists on a menu driven-on-line database system designed to provide customers with access to products and services under GSA contracts. Contractors will be encouraged to transmit their file submission electronically through the EDI Government facnet system using a value added network (Van). The necessary format and information will be provided on diskette to contractors who are not EDI capable.
